Lansdowne Partners, one of London's leading hedge funds, just filed its 13f for first quarter of 2014. The long/short equity hedge fund added 19 new stocks to its portfolio in the period, including names like Verizon Communications Inc. (NYSE:VZ), Tesla Motors Inc (NASDAQ:TSLA), Morgan Stanley (NYSE:MS) and Illumina, Inc. (NASDAQ:ILMN).

Lansdowne Buys Tesla Motors Inc; Sells Citigroup Inc, GM

The fund's largest positions are in Comcast Corporation (NASDAQ:CMCSA), J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M), Delta Air Lines, Inc. (NYSE:DAL), Wells Fargo & Co (NYSE:WFC) and Amazon.com,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MZN).
